I have a sixteen gallon tank. I let it cycle for 2 days with a Tetra tech 20-40 filter, 160 gallons per hour. I introduced two Buenos Aires Tetra's. Was it to soon to add fish?

Unless you added some bacteria to "instant" cycle the filter media you will definitely end up with an ammonia spike that will likely kill the fish.
